L'Oreal acquires South Korea's Dr.G in skincare deal with Migros

L'Oreal acquires South Korean skincare brand Dr.G from Migros, aiming to capitalize on the growing global popularity of K-Beauty. The acquisition will boost Dr.G's presence in South Korea and internationally, meeting rising demand for effective and affordable skincare. This follows L'Oreal's previous acquisition of South Korean makeup firm 3CE in 2018.
